Sierra Pacific Patio Sliding Doors create a graceful transition from your indoor to outdoor living areas. While providing the perfect solution for a space-saving opening, these doors also optimize your view and allow your home to fill with warm sunlight.
Secure and durable as they are beautiful, our Patio Sliding Doors feature a multi-point locking system for optimum security and weather resistance. Our gear mechanism is made from corrosion-resistant 300 Series Stainless Steel and our locking system has passed the most stringent forced entry requirements.
Our doors feature solid brass forged handles and escutcheon plates for strength, durability and a smooth, blemish-free surface. Available in a variety of finishes, our handles and escutcheons complement virtually any design scheme.
